  • How can I use my ipad in a hotel that only has ethernet connections.    The apple store clerk told me that I can't use airport express unless I also have a computer with me in the hotel.

    How can I use my Ipad in a hotel that only has ethernet connections?  The Apple store clerk told me that travel express won't work in my hotel unless I also have a computer.

    The issue with the Airport Express (or any of the Apple routers) is that you need the Airport Utility to configure it.  Airport Utility works on OSX and Windows, but not on the iPad (or iPhone or iPod Touch.)  It will work, if you can preconfigure the Airport correctly ahead of time, but you'd be stuck if you did need to reconfigure while at the hotel.
    You can use most any other router that is configured with a web page, which means you have a chance of configuring with Safari on the iPad.  If you want something somewhat portable, I use a "travel router" made by D-Link. The current model is the DAP-1350.  Other companies make similar travel routers, but I have no experience with the others.
